How to Use A/B Testing to Improve Your Website’s UX

Evan Morgan

Evan Morgan

November 12, 2024

How to Use A/B Testing to Improve Your Website’s UX

In the digital age, the user experience (UX) of a website is pivotal to its success. Every click, scroll, and interaction can either lead to higher conversion rates or a frustrating experience that drives users away. One of the most effective strategies to enhance UX is through A/B testing. This method enables website owners to make data-driven decisions by comparing two versions of a webpage to see which one performs better.


1. What is A/B Testing?

A/B testing, also known as split testing, involves comparing two variations of a webpage or element to assess which performs better in terms of user engagement and conversions. By presenting different versions to different segments of users, you can collect data on how each performs in the real world.

The process typically involves:

  • Creating two versions (A and B) of a webpage or element.
  • Dividing traffic between these versions.
  • Analyzing user behavior and conversion metrics to determine which version is more effective.

With accurate A/B testing, webmasters can identify preferences, increase usability, and ultimately enhance conversions.


2. Why is A/B Testing Important for UX?

Improving user experience is not just about aesthetics; it’s fundamentally about functionality and satisfaction. Here’s why A/B testing is a crucial element in enhancing UX:

  • Data-Driven Decisions: Instead of guesswork, A/B testing provides real data on user preferences, helping you make informed decisions that significantly enhance UX.
  • Increase Conversion Rates: Small changes in design or content can have a profound impact on conversion rates. A/B testing helps identify the changes that bring the best results.
  • Identify Trouble Areas: A/B testing helps you pinpoint areas where users may be dropping off or experiencing issues, allowing you to address these swiftly.
  • Improvement Over Time: Continuous testing can result in a gradual improvement in UX, as each iteration provides insights for future changes.

Ultimately, the goal of A/B testing is to maintain a user-centered approach, ensuring that your website meets the needs and expectations of your visitors.


3. How to Set Up A/B Testing

Setting up A/B testing is a straightforward process. Here’s a step-by-step guide to get you started:

Step 1: Identify Your Goal

Before you start testing, define clear goals. Are you looking to increase clicks on a call-to-action button? Or perhaps you want to improve newsletter sign-ups? Having a specific goal will guide your testing process and help you measure success.

Step 2: Choose What to Test

Not everything needs testing. Focus on specific elements that can impact user experience, such as:

  • Headlines and CTAs (Call-to-Actions)
  • Landing page layouts
  • Images and graphics
  • Form designs and fields

Step 3: Create Variations

Develop two variations of the element or page you want to test. Version A typically represents the current state (control), while version B contains the modification you wish to evaluate.

Step 4: Use A/B Testing Tools

Numerous tools exist to conduct A/B tests, such as Google Optimize, Optimizely, and VWO. These platforms offer features to easily manage tests and analyze results.

Step 5: Run the Test

Drive traffic to both versions of the page and let the test run for a sufficient period. The duration largely depends on your traffic volume and the number of conversions you need to gather statistical significance.

Step 6: Analyze Results

Once the test completes, analyze the results to see which variation performed better concerning your defined goals. Review metrics to draw insights about users’ interactions with each version.

Step 7: Implement Changes

Use the insights gained from the analysis to inform decisions and implement the better-performing version on your website.


4. Best Practices for A/B Testing

For successful A/B testing, consider these best practices:

  • Test One Element at a Time: Focusing on a single change helps you accurately determine its impact on performance without confounding results.
  • Determine Sample Size: Ensure your sample size is large enough to yield statistically significant results, which will depend upon your average traffic and conversion rates.
  • Run Tests for Sufficient Duration: Allow enough time for variations to gather enough data, considering things like weekdays vs. weekends or seasonality in your sector.
  • Be Patient: Sometimes results may show delays. Avoid changing elements too quickly based on initial impressions; allow the test to reach conclusive results before taking action.

By adhering to these best practices, you’re setting your A/B tests up for success and creating a more user-friendly website.


5. A/B Testing Success Stories

Many companies have effectively used A/B testing to enhance their UX and increase conversions. Here are some noteworthy examples:

  • Optimizely: This A/B testing platform improved their own conversion rates by 50% by changing the wording on their homepage’s call-to-action buttons. Their case illustrates how language can powerfully affect user behavior.
  • Airbnb: By testing different images for their searches, Airbnb discovered that one image increased click-through rates significantly. The test confirmed that visuals play a critical role in UX, especially in travel and listings.
  • Google: The tech giant famously ran A/B tests on their search button, testing different shades of blue. This seemingly trivial change resulted in an estimated increase of $200 million in revenue annually, showcasing the vast potential of A/B testing even in minor areas.

These examples confirm that A/B testing can yield substantial results and lead to enhanced user experiences.


Conclusion

A/B testing is a powerful technique for improving UX on websites. By systematically comparing variations, gathering data, and making informed decisions, you can create an intuitive and engaging user experience that not only satisfies visitor needs but also boosts your conversion rates. Embrace A/B testing as a part of your UX strategy, and watch as your website evolves based on evidence and user feedback.

More articles for you